About the Book

Antichrist is a book that traces the doctrine of the Antichrist from the Book of Genesis to the Book of Revelation, and shows definitively (I think) how the world is naturally divided into just two groups – those who consciously or otherwise follow the Antichrist (which is essentially a spirit of humanism), and those who follow the Spirit of Christ. This topic perpetually fascinates (and scares) people but is usually taught quite badly. In fact, understanding this doctrine properly helps one to understand history as a whole. Ancient patterns of conflict between Israel and other nations will continue to the end, until a Muslim (UN backed) invasion of Israel will usher in the final political Antichrist, followed by a final global push to exterminate deism. Antichrist is not just the “Man of Sin”, but is fundamentally a spirit that rules the mind of Man. Christ and Antichrist exist in every person, and a person is called to choose his allegiance. I think this book, by setting Christ against Antichrist, deism versus humanism, faith in divine revelation versus faith in human logic, makes one of the clearest explanations of the Christian faith that one will be able to find. Indeed, escape from Antichrist is ultimately escape from ones sinful self.
